Understanding Miles per Hour and Kilometers per Hour

Miles per hour (mph) and kilometers per hour (km/h) are both units of speed measurement. As the names suggest, mph is used in countries that follow the imperial system of measurement, such as the United States and the United Kingdom. On the other hand, km/h is used in countries that follow the metric system of measurement, such as Canada, Australia, and most of Europe.

The conversion rate between mph and km/h is as follows:

1 mph = 1.609344 km/h

This means that for every 1 mile per hour, the speed is equivalent to 1.609344 kilometers per hour. Therefore, to convert any speed from mph to km/h, you need to multiply the mph value by 1.609344. Similarly, to convert any speed from km/h to mph, you need to divide the km/h value by 1.609344.

Converting 120 Miles per Hour to Kilometers per Hour

Now that we have a basic understanding of mph and km/h, let's take a look at converting 120 miles per hour to kilometers per hour. To do this, we simply need to multiply 120 by 1.609344. The calculation is as follows:

120 mph x 1.609344 = 193.12128 km/h

Therefore, 120 miles per hour is equivalent to 193.12128 kilometers per hour. This means that if you are driving at 120 miles per hour, you are traveling at a speed of 193.12128 kilometers per hour.

How to Convert Miles per Hour to Kilometers per Hour

Converting miles per hour to kilometers per hour is a simple process. All you need to do is multiply the mph value by 1.609344. Here's a step-by-step guide:

Step 1: Write down the mph value

For example, let's say we want to convert 50 miles per hour to kilometers per hour.

Step 2: Multiply the mph value by 1.609344

Using the conversion rate we discussed earlier, we can multiply 50 by 1.609344:

50 mph x 1.609344 = 80.4672 km/h

Therefore, 50 miles per hour is equivalent to 80.4672 kilometers per hour.
